Q: Is 667,348 a Prime Number?
A: No, 667,348 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 667348 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 11 22 29 44 58 116 319 523 638 1,046 1,276 2,092 5,753 11,506 15,167 23,012 30,334 60,668 166,837 333,674 and 667,348, with no remainder.
Since 667,348 cannot be divided by just 1 and 667,348, it is not a prime number.
